If you live in the United States, you do not need a passport unless you are planning to venture into Canadian territory from Alaska. If you have tested positive for Covid, you should not travel to Alaska until you’ve completed necessary quarantine practices and receive clearance for travel by a medical professional. However, there are no vaccine requirements for entering the state unless required by a specific cruise line.

In Alaska, there are vast areas that are inaccessible by road, making travel a unique adventure. Depending on the region you wish to explore and the activities you want to engage in, there are several modes of transportation available. Small bush planes and helicopters, known as air taxis, are the preferred means for reaching many remote locations. For those traveling by water, cruises, boat charters, and ferries are great options for accessing secluded areas. During the winter months, dogsledding becomes a popular mode of transport in certain regions. Additionally, off-road vehicle rentals can be arranged for more adventurous travelers.
